计划发布 Web 服务

可以从你的编排中访问 Web 服务。 还可以使用 BizTalk Web 服务发布向导发布 Web 服务。

下表列出了在规划 Web 服务时需要回答的一些问题。

规划问题 建议
是否已生成 BizTalk Server 项目? 在运行 BizTalk Web 服务发布向导之前,必须生成 BizTalk Server 项目。
是否使系统能够运行 Web 服务? 在运行 BizTalk Web 服务发布向导之前,必须在计算机上启用 Web 服务。 有关为 Web 服务启用系统的详细信息,请参阅 “启用 Web 服务”。
是否已验证架构是否仅包含有效的 XML 字符和元素? Web 服务不支持中文、日语或朝鲜语(CJK)统一象形字扩展 A 字符。 某些 XML 架构 (XSD) 元素也有限制。 有关有效的 XML 字符和支持的元素以及元素注意事项的详细信息,请参阅 发布 Web 服务时的注意事项
BizTalk Server 项目中的任何消息类型是否都使用用户定义的 .NET 类? 必须将包含用户定义 .NET 类的程序集安装到全局程序集缓存(GAC)中,这些程序集被消息类型引用。
Web 客户端是否使用 WindowsUser 上下文属性提供的凭据? 使用已发布 Web 服务的 Web 客户端提供的凭据使用 WindowsUser 上下文属性。 Party Resolution 使用此属性。 如果通过WindowsUser上下文属性设置参与方,并且 Web 客户端使用与该参与方匹配的凭据来调用 Web 服务,BizTalk Server 会将该消息识别为来自相应的预定义参与方。 有关管道组件参与方解析的详细信息,请参阅 “参与方解析管道组件”。

另请参阅

发布 Web 服务